Lizal Tri-Boomerangs are Boomerangs with three blades that are typically carried by Black Lizalfos.[1] They are also used by Silver Lizalfos, Golden Lizalfos, Fire-Breath Lizalfos, Ice-Breath Lizalfos, and Electric Lizalfos. They can be thrown to attack Enemies at a range, but they must be caught before returning to Link or else he will take damage. Alternatively, they can be used as melee Weapons. These Boomerangs are part of the Lizalfos Gear equipment archetype.[3] They are commonly found in the Hebra Mountains and the Akkala Highlands.
As metallic Weapons, Lizal Tri-Boomerangs will conduct Electricity and attract Lightning when equipped during Thunderstorms. They can also be picked up using the Magnesis Rune on the Sheikah Slate, but they will sink if they are dropped in Water.

Name | Value | Description |
---|---|---|
ActorName | "Weapon_Sword_009" | Internal name |
Life | 27 | Durability of the weapon |
Power | 36 | Damage dealt with the weapon |
SpHitActor | "" | Objects that receive additional damage from the weapon |
SpHitRatio | 2.0 | Damage multiplier appplied to SpHitActor objects |
IsHammer | false | Whether or not the weapon can break ore deposits in one hit |
IsWeakBreaker | false | Unknown use, maybe was used during dev to one hit kill weaker enemies ? |
IsBoomerang | true | Whether or not the weapon comes back to the player if they throw it |
IsLuckyWeapon | false | Unknown use, maybe was used to have random crits during dev ? |
IsPikohan | false | Whether or not the weapon launches the enemies at the end of a combo or after a charged attack (Spring-Loaded Hammer behavior) |
IsThrowingWeapon | true | Whether or not the weapon can be thrown |
IsThrowingBreakWeapon | false | Whether or not the weapon breaks instantly when thrown to an enemy |
ThrowRange | 5.0 | After being thrown, travelled distance of the weapon before getting affected with gravity |
ChemicalEnergyMax | 0 | The maximal amount of energy elemental weapons have. If it falls to zero, the weapon is uncharged and you have to wait until it's charged again [a] |
ChemicalEnergyAmountUsed | 0 | The energy cost elemental weapons have when using their power |
ChemicalEnergyRecoverRate | 0.0 | Speed, in unit/frame, of the energy recovery of the weapon |
ChemicalEnergyRecoverInterval | 60 | Frames you have to wait, after your last attack, before the weapon starts to recharge itself |
ShootBeam | "" | If specified, what actor to launch when throwing the weapon |
SharpWeaponAddAtkMin | 6 | Minimal value for level 1 attack up modifier |
SharpWeaponAddAtkMax | 12 | Maximal value for level 1 attack up modifier |
SharpWeaponAddLifeMin | 3 | Minimal value for level 1 durability up modifier |
SharpWeaponAddLifeMax | 6 | Maximal value for level 1 durability up modifier |
SharpWeaponAddCrit | true | Whether or not the weapon can get the critical hit modifier |
PoweredSharpAddAtkMin | 13 | Minimal value for level 2 attack up modifier |
PoweredSharpAddAtkMax | 24 | Maximal value for level 2 attack up modifier |
PoweredSharpAddLifeMin | 7 | Minimal value for level 2 durability up modifier |
PoweredSharpAddLifeMax | 14 | Maximal value for level 2 durability up modifier |
PoweredSharpAddThrowMin | 1.0 | Minimal value for throw distance up modifier |
PoweredSharpAddThrowMax | 1.0 | Maximal value for throw distance up modifier |
ThrowSpeed | 1.0 | Initial speed of the weapon when thrown |
ThrowRotSpeed | 1500.0 | Rotation speed, in radian per second, of the weapon when thrown |
SellingPrice | 30 | Unused value for the weapons, probably a leftover from a dev build where you could sell your weapons |
BuyingPrice | 69 | Unused value for the weapons, probably a leftover from a dev build where you could buy weapons |
